Almost 1,000 million euros: the third largest prize in Powerball history drawn in Los Angeles

This Wednesday one of the biggest prizes of the North American Powerball lottery was raffled: 1,080 million dollars (960 million euros). Compared to the European reality, it is the equivalent of five times the biggest jackpot in the history of EuroMillions.

The winning ticket was sold in a minimarket in Los Angeles, California, with the code 7, 10, 11, 13, 24 and Powerball number 24.

The identity of the winner is not known, but it is known that only one ticket with the full key was sold, reveals CNN.

This is the third largest prize in Powerball history, following last year’s prizes of $2.04 billion and $1.585 billion in 2016. Additionally, it is the seventh largest prize ever awarded in draws in the United States. Joined.

This after 38 consecutive draws without anyone being able to hit the full draw and win the first lottery prize, since April 19.

The odds of winning the jackpot were 1 in 292.2 million.
